Any dispute, controversy, or claim arising out of or in connection with these Terms or the services (“Dispute”) shall be resolved as follows:
Good-Faith Negotiation. The parties shall first attempt to resolve the Dispute through good-faith negotiations.
Mediation. If the Dispute is not resolved within thirty (30) days of written notice, either party may refer the Dispute to mediation administered by a mutually agreed mediation body.
Arbitration. If the Dispute is not resolved through mediation within sixty (60) days, the Dispute may be finally resolved by arbitration conducted by a single arbitrator, seated in Accra, Ghana, in the English language, and governed by the laws of the Republic of Ghana.
Court Relief. Nothing in this clause prevents either party from seeking urgent injunctive or equitable relief from a court of competent jurisdiction.
